Responsibilities:
* Design and develop technical solutions, starting from the functional requirements, following our quality/security/legal guidelines and standards
* Develop efficient, pragmatic, user-friendly, and easy-to-maintain Java applications
* Ensure quality (unit/integration/acceptance tests, continuous inspection, documentation, Sonar compliance, OWASP checks…)
* Contribute to the development of Service Oriented Architecture (SOA)
* Contribute to the continuous improvement of development processes
* Work in an Agile environment
Qualifications:
* Experience with Spring, Spring Boot, web, Hibernate, Maven, REST, JPA, SQL Server
* Experience with Docker/Kubernetes, CI/CD in GCP
* Experience with AWS
* Experience with BDD, TDD, and DDD; should be able to apply them in your everyday development tasks
* Extensive experience with REST and SOA
* Proven experience with HTML/CSS, JavaScript, and related technologies
* Experience in Angular/React or similar framework development
* Experience with frontend development patterns: Smart/Dumb Components, Redux, etc.
* Experience in reactive development: RxJS, etc.
* Experience with web designing and related technologies
#J-18808-Ljbffr